A Brief History of Currency Counterfeiting in Germany
Counterfeiting has a long and storied history worldwide, and Germany is no exception. The country has seen its share of counterfeiting efforts, especially throughout numerous crises in history:
Weimar Republic (1919-1933): Following World War I, Germany dealt with run-away inflation, which resulted in an abundance of counterfeit notes. The fast depreciation of currency made the economy susceptible to counterfeiters.
Post-War Era: In the aftermath of World War II, the establishment of the Deutsche Mark in 1948 brought a clean slate, however also a resurgence of counterfeiting. The introduction of sophisticated security functions helped suppress this trend.
Euro Adoption: With the introduction of the Euro in 2002, Germany needed to adjust to a new currency format. This offered counterfeiters with a new target, causing ongoing efforts by Deutsche Bundesbank (the German reserve bank) to enhance security steps.
Approaches Employed by Counterfeiters
Counterfeiters employ a range of strategies to create fake banknotes that can deceive the typical person. Some of the most typical methods consist of:
Digital Printing: Advances in technology have made it easier for counterfeiters to print high-quality replicas of banknotes utilizing high-resolution printers and scanners.
Copy machines: People typically undervalue the ability of modern-day photocopying innovation to recreate images with amazing precision. Counterfeiters commonly use copiers to generate counterfeit notes and might alter them with the help of software.
Old Equipment: Some counterfeiters utilize older methods, such as hand-drawing functions or stamps, although this is less typical in the digital age.
Professional Forge Operations: Organized criminal offense groups may run sophisticated forgery operations using skilled service technicians who develop innovative replicas, including the use of UV inks and embedded security components.
Comprehending these approaches is crucial for the public and companies to defend against counterfeit currency.

How to Identify Genuine German Banknotes
Recognizing the credibility of banknotes is important for customers, retailers, and businesses. Here is a concise guide on how to recognize real German banknotes:

Counterfeiters often target greater denominations, such as EUR50, EUR100, and EUR200, due to the larger earnings they can yield. However, smaller sized denominations are not immune.
How can I report a counterfeit banknote?
If you suspect you have gotten a counterfeit banknote, report it immediately to your local police department and submit the note to a bank for analysis.
Are there any technological tools for detecting counterfeit banknotes?
Yes, a number of gadgets are readily available for merchants and banks, including UV lights and counterfeit detection pens that respond to the specific functions of genuine currency.
Can counterfeit banknotes be successfully passed off in everyday deals?
While counterfeiters try to circulate fake banknotes, the enhanced awareness and security features of legitimate currency make it increasingly challenging to pass off counterfeit notes without detection.
